martes, 16 de junio de 2015

Conclusión

Conclusión final:
A pesar de ser nuestra primera tarea programada y el hecho de que Vinicio, Will y yo nunca hemos trabajado juntos y desconociamos nuestros procesos personales, esta tarea salió muy bien, con unos pocos errores que no tomamos en cuenta que nos harían tanto daño en el proceso de la inserción de datos, la conectividad de los sp y la base, pensamos en mejorar estos aspectos en las siguientes oportunidades de trabajo, tanto en el diseño del modelo como en el diseño gráfico de la base de datos.
Aprendimos a no manejar tantos NULL, ya que provocan muchos errores en la base.
Pensamos que a pesar de la plantilla de evaluación estaba dura nos apegamos muy bien a lo que había que completar, a continuación el veredicto grupal:
  1. Documentación: La documentación está muy completa, la entrada a los blogs están distribuidos en el tiempo, ya que empezamos la progra muy temprano, Las horas están muy consistentes ya que ambos miembros del grupo trabajamos arduamente las últimas 5 semanas. Veredicto de la documentación 100%
  2. Diseño e implementación de la base de datos: La base de datos está muy completa, con pequeños errores NO críticos permite la buena evaluación de la misma, FKs en diferentes tablas que complementan los tipos de datos dados y de acuerdo a como los vimos en clase, las tablas correctamente ordenadas y adecuadamente interconectadas. Veredicto del diseño de la base de datos 100%
  3. Migración masiva de datos básicos. La lectura del XML fue muy sencilla, el problema fue el cambio ya mencionado en la última entrada, los cambios a los que no estábamos acostumbrados en el XML nos tomó mucho tiempo. Veredicto de datos básicos y migración de datos 100%
  4. Código de la aplicación de escritorio: Trabajamos muy bien en esta parte de la tarea, aunque tuvimos problemas para unir el código con los SP, nos trabaja muy bien la lectura y una parte de inserción de datos, sin embargo el código está completo y en una futura versión funcional, tenemos problemas menores con la conversión de datos de el java.util a el java.sql, al parecer existe cierta incompatibilidad entre ambas y no pudimos solucionar el problema. Veredicto del código de la aplicación de escritorio 90%
  5. Código de la aplicación WEB: Trabajamos muy bien en esta parte de la tarea, aunque tuvimos problemas para unir el código con los SP, nos trabaja muy bien la lectura y una parte de inserción de datos, sin embargo el código está completo y en una futura versión funcional, tenemos problemas menores con la conversión de datos de el java.util a el java.sql, al parecer existe cierta incompatibilidad entre ambas y no pudimos solucionar el problema. Veredicto del código de la aplicación WEB 90%
  6. Código en SP: Sabemos que el código está correcto, con manejo de errores, completo, retorno de valores positivos o negativos dependiendo del error. Tomando en cuenta el manejo de transacciones, (los múltiples cálculos), las actualizaciones entre tablas están muy completas., tuvimos muchos problemas con los permisos de administrador en la base de datos, cuando intentábamos acceder a alguna función del SQL no nos dejaba, por la falta de permisos de administrador, es un problema que necesitamos mejorar para la siguiente programada, nos faltaron pequeños detalles en la elaboración de algunos SP, sin embargo están muy completos y estamos satisfechos con el resultado. Veredicto final del código en SP 90%

La idea de las tareas programadas es aprender y pensamos que esta cumplió su objetivo, esperamos tener la siguiente al 100% evitar contratiempos del software, uniendo nuestros conocimientos y aplicándolos mejor, evitar cometer los mismos errores y agregar la retroalimentación del profesor en el futuro.


Horas totales trabajadas por miembro del grupo:
35 horas.

No hay comentarios:

Publicar un comentario